If your car is under repair following an accident in the UAE, you might be eligible for a replacement vehicle. Replacement cars, also known as courtesy cars, are often provided under motor insurance policies to minimize disruption during repairs.

What Is a Replacement Car?

A replacement car is a temporary vehicle offered through comprehensive motor insurance policies when your insured vehicle is involved in an accident. Coverage durations typically range from 7 to 15 days, depending on your insurer and policy terms.

Eligibility for a Replacement Car

Eligibility depends on the type of accident and your insurance policy:

  • Own Fault Accidents: Replacement cars are available if your policy includes this benefit. After registering your claim, the car is usually delivered within 24 to 48 hours.

  • Non-Fault Accidents: The at-fault party’s insurer provides a replacement car once repair estimates are approved.

Types of Insurance and Replacement Car Benefits

  • Comprehensive Insurance: Replacement car benefits are typically an add-on option.

  • Third-Party Insurance: In non-fault accidents, you may receive a substitute vehicle or a monetary allowance from the at-fault party’s insurer, usually for up to 15 days.

When Replacement Cars Are Not Covered

Replacement cars are not provided in cases where:

  • The policyholder has not opted for the car hire add-on.

  • The damage is caused by circumstances not covered under the policy, such as intentional harm or driving under the influence.

Policy Duration: Per Accident vs. Per Policy Year

Replacement car benefits may be capped based on your policy:

  • Per Accident Basis: You can use a replacement car for a set number of days after each insured accident.

  • Per Policy Year Basis: Coverage is limited to a total number of days per year, regardless of the number of accidents.

Non-Fault Accidents and Replacement Cars

If you are not at fault in an accident, the other driver’s insurer covers the cost of a replacement car. This applies even if your own policy lacks the courtesy car benefit.

Choosing Your Replacement Car

In own-fault accidents, options are usually limited to vehicles provided by your insurer. For non-fault accidents, you can often rent a car of your choice within an approved budget, with reimbursement available upon submitting the invoice.

Planning for Vehicle Downtime

Understanding the terms and limits of your motor insurance policy is crucial to avoid unexpected disruptions. Whether it’s opting for add-ons like the car hire benefit or being aware of non-fault rights, proper preparation ensures a smoother recovery after an accident.
